How they compare
Kazakhstan currently reports 77.27 against 76.05 in Costa Rica, a difference of 1.22.
The two have swapped places 7 times across 31 shared years of data; in 1994 it was Costa Rica ahead.
Costa Rica ranks 90th and Kazakhstan ranks 87th of 109 countries.
Across the 4 decades both report, Costa Rica averaged higher in 3 and Kazakhstan in 1.
Head to head by decade
| Decade | Costa Rica | Kazakhstan |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 96.69 | 23.05 | 73.64 | Costa Rica |
| 2000s | 87.7 | 50.77 | 36.92 | Costa Rica |
| 2010s | 98.72 | 95.43 | 3.29 | Costa Rica |
| 2020s | 68.65 | 105.11 | 36.46 | Kazakhstan |
Averages of every year both report within each decade.

About this data
The FAO indices of agricultural production show the relative level of the aggregate volume of agricultural production for each year in comparison with the base period 2014-2016. Indices for meat production are computed based on data on production from indigenous animals.
